Introduction#

The Acebeam UC3A is a small EDC keyring torch with dual white LEDs and an RGB side light. It is powered by one 10440/AAA battery.

Torch in use#

The Acebeam UC3A is a bit on the larger size for a keyring torch.

Acebeam UC3A in-use-1 Acebeam UC3A in-use-2

It can be clipped onto a backpack or a pocket with the pocket clip.

Acebeam UC3A in-use-3

There is a lanyard hole for a lanyard (not included) or a the included keyring. The keyring is a bit large for the lanyard hole and it will get stuck if you try to rotate it. A smaller ring would help with movement.

Acebeam UC3A closeup-lanyard-hole Acebeam UC3A closeup-keyring

There is a powerful magnet in the tailcap. It is strong enough to hold the torch at a right-angle.

CCT, CRI, and duv#

I have taken Correlated Colour Temperature (CCT) and Colour Rendering Index (CRI, RA of R1-R8) measurements with the torch positioned half a metre away from an Opple Light Master Pro III (G3) for the main light and about 2cm away for the side light.

The CCT is around 6600K, the CRI is around 72 and the Delta u, v is negative (rosy) for the Main Light.

The CCT is around 4800K, the CRI is around 99 and the Delta u, v is positive (green) for the Side Light.

The beam produced has an intense white hot spot surrounded by a corona and a spill. There are some artefacts around the edge of the oval-shaped spill.

LED Mode CCT (K) CRI (Ra) x y Duv
Main Ultra Low 6474 71.8 0.3140 0.3232 -0.0005
Main Low 6559 72.8 0.3128 0.3214 -0.0008
Main Med 6655 73.0 0.3116 0.3185 -0.0017
Main High 6888 73.9 0.3090 0.3114 -0.0042
Side Low 4808 100.0 0.3525 0.3709 0.0066
Side High 4828 98.5 0.3519 0.3710 0.0068

User interface#

The Acebeam UC3A has two buttons:

  • a Main Light Switch to control the Main Light and;
  • an Auxiliary Light Switch (RGB) to control the Side Light

Acebeam UC3A closeup-buttons

The Main Light has four modes: Ultra Low, Low, Med and High. There is also a Strobe mode.

The Side Light has nine modes: White, Red, Red Flash, Green, Green Flash, Blue, Blue Flash, Red-Blue Flash, Rainbow Flow. If you count the change in brightness for the first seven modes then there are sixteen modes for the Side Light.

Main Light Switch#

State Action Result
Off Press and hold Ultra Low
Off Press and hold for 3 seconds Lock
Locked Press and hold for 3 seconds Unlock
Locked Click Auxiliary Light flashes red/green
Off Click Med
Off Two clicks High
Off Three clicks Strobe
On Press and hold Cycle (Low, Medium, High)
On Three clicks Strobe
On Click Off

Auxiliary Light Switch#

State Action Result
Off Press and hold Low
Off Click High
On Two clicks Cycle (White, Red, Red Flash, Green, Green Flash, Blue, Blue Flash, Red Blue Flash, Rainbow Flow)
White, Red, Red Flash, Green, Green Flash, Blue, Blue Flash Press and hold Change brightness (Low, High)
On Click Off

Mode memory#

There is no mode memory. The Main Light defaults to Med and the Side Light defaults to White High.

Batteries and charging#

Battery#

The Acebeam UC3A comes with an Acebeam AB10CP40 10440 3.7V Li-ion 400mAh cell. It arrived with a voltage of 3.82V.

The torch works with a 10440 3.7V Li-ion cell, a 1.5V AAA Alkaline battery or a 1.2V NiMH AAA battery.

Acebeam UC3A battery-1 Acebeam UC3A battery-2

The battery was isolated with a piece of plastic so that the torch does not accidentally turn on while in the packaging.

Acebeam UC3A closeup-insulating-strip

I tried the following cells:

Cell Top Compatible?
10440 3.7V Li-ion 350mAh Flat No
Acebeam AB10CP40 10440 3.7V Li-ion 400mAh Button Yes
eneloop pro AAA 1.2V Ni-MH 900mAh Button Yes

Physical reverse polarity protection near the positive terminal prevents flat top cells from being used.

Acebeam UC3A closeup-positive-terminal

Charging#

The torch does not have built-in charging. Instead, the included 10440 cell has USB-C charging.

Power supply: PinePower Desktop USB-C
USB Meter: ChargerLAB Power-Z KM003C Amazon Australia
Room temperature: 10 C

Acebeam UC3A charging profile

It took 1 hours 22 minutes to charge the Lithium battery from 2.91V to 4.15V at a rate of 5V/0.38A.

The charging status indicator at the head of the battery is red while charging and it becomes green when charging is complete.

Runtime#

Here is a summary of the runtime results:

Cell LED Mode User manual Runtime Turn off Final voltage
10440 Main High 15s + 14min + 26min 45min 43s 2h 31min 49s 2.91
10440 Main Med 30min + 1h 1h 27min 35s 3h 15min 10s 2.85
10440 Main Low 1h 50min 3h 32min 52s 5h 8min 43s 2.96
10440 Main Ultra Low 23h 24h+ 24h+ 3.45
NiMH Main High 2h 22min 11s 3h 25min 28s 1.05
NiMH Main Med 2h 33min 13s 3h 36min 31s 1.12
NiMH Main Low 4h 25min 22s 5h 4min 30s 1.14
NiMH Main Ultra Low 23h 32min 33s 23h 32min 33s 1.07

“Runtime” is the time until the output reduces to 10% of the output at 30 seconds (as per the ANSI/PLATO FL1 2019 Standard).

“Turn off” is the time until my DIY lumen tube no longer detects more than 1 lumen.

“+” indicates that the light remained on after recording had stopped.

The runtimes are slightly better than expected.

The output is well regulated.

Throw#

I took lux measurements with a UNI-T UT383BT at 30 seconds. High was measured at one metre.

Cell Mode Specs (cd) Specs (m) Candela measured (cd) Distance (m)
10440 High 1,805 85 1,360 73

It is worth noting that the included cell was charged up to 4.17V instead of 4.20V before measuring the beam distance for the High mode.

Conclusion#

The Acebeam UC3A is better than I expected.

I am not really sure what I expected. But a slightly rosy beam with well regulated output is a nice surprise!

It would be even better if the Main Light had a High CRI. The Side Light appears to have a High CRI.

The lumen output and beam distance for High were slightly lower expected when I measured it but this could be because I could only get the included battery to charge up to 4.17V instead of fully charge to 4.20V. It could also be due to the accuracy of my DIY lumen tube (off by about 10%).

The user interface is relatively simple due to the two buttons. It seems geared toward general users rather than being overly complex for enthusiasts. That said, I would love to see a mode memory for the Side Light.
